Sunrepack 2025 Rates


The document establishes the 2025 tariffs for SUN REPACK, a collective extended producer responsibility system (SCRAP) for packaging. It states that there is no membership fee, but companies must make financial contributions (€/kg) depending on the type of material (plastic, metal, paper/cardboard, wood, cork, ceramic, textile, rubber/leather, glass, and others). There are two reporting options (simplified up to 15,000 kg/year and regular reporting above that figure), with "effective" or "provisional" options, and mandatory quarterly reports. An annual minimum of €256 is established to ensure compliance with legal obligations.
 

Sunrepack 2026 Rates


The document establishes the 2026 rates for packaging managed under the SUN REPACK (SCRAP) system. There is no membership fee, and three declaration options are established (provisional, effective, and annual), with quarterly reports and mandatory annual notification to the Ministry of the Environment and Natural Resources (MITERD). Rates vary by material (plastics, metals, paper/cardboard, glass, wood, cork, ceramics, textiles, rubber/leather, and others), expressed in €/kg. An annual minimum of €256 is maintained. As a new feature, the financial contribution modulation is incorporated, applying bonuses or penalties based on criteria of durability, recyclability, reusability, and the presence of hazardous substances.
